Beaton is a perfect example of how a story can whisk you away to unexpected places. Agatha Raisin, the protagonist, is a woman who, despite her busy life, still feels the sting of loneliness. It’s a feeling many of us can relate to, and it makes her journey all the more compelling. When her ex-husband, James Lacey, reappears and invites her on a surprise holiday, Agatha jumps at the chance, hoping for a romantic getaway. But life, as we often find in books and in reality, has a way of throwing us curveballs. The destination, Snoth-on-Sea, is far from the idyllic retreat Agatha imagined. The once-grand Palace Hotel is in disrepair, and the atmosphere is chilly, both literally and figuratively. It’s a reminder that sometimes, the places we visit in books can be as surprising as the characters we meet. Among the guests are the Jankers, a newlywed couple who quickly become Agatha’s adversaries. Tensions rise, and before long, the story takes a dark turn with the murder of Geraldine Jankers. Agatha’s scarf is found book free the scene, making her a prime suspect. It’s a twist that keeps you on the edge of your seat, much like the best mysteries do.
